TWC Buys Stake in Starz Media

2011/01/04 22:53:25 +00:00 | Jonathan James

The Weinstein Company has announced the purchase of a 25% stake in Starz Media, allowing them to work with Anchor Bay Entertainment (a Starz company) on DVD/Blu-Ray releases:

"The home/digital entertainment deal, which does not include television rights but spans Blu-ray™, DVD and EST/VOD/PPV electronic/digital distribution, covers up to 20 TWC and Dimension titles per year including ...

...upcoming sequels in the successful Scream, Spy Kids, and Scary Movie franchises, and new installments in the Hellraiser, Halloween, and Children of the Corn film series."

Anchor Bay has consistently been releasing horror titles for years and this will help strengthen their catalog and brand. I'll be interested in seeing what The Weinstein Company's future horror plans are as they seem to be investing heavily on the genre and their existing properties.
